WebHere we compared the effects of bumetanide (0.3 or 10 mg/kg i.p.), midazolam (1 mg/kg i.p.), and a combination of bumetanide and midazolam on neonatal seizures and later-life outcomes in this model. While bumetanide at either dose was ineffective when administered alone, the higher dose of bumetanide markedly potentiated midazolam's effect on ... WebSep 9, 2024 · Most people with epilepsy live long lives. According to the Epilepsy Foundation, people with seizures with no known cause may die, on average, two years sooner than otherwise expected. People with seizures with a known cause (such as head trauma) may die 10 years earlier than expected.
